Chelsea keen on Stones and Lukaku as part of Conte’s overhaul


Chelsea are still keen on signing Everton duo Romelu Lukaku and John Stones as they prepare for a major squad overhaul under Antonio Conte this summer.

Lukaku first came to England as one of the brightest young talents in Europe, joining Chelsea from Anderlecht, but he never managed to break into the first team at Stamford Bridge.

However, after four years of regularly scoring in the top flight during spells West Bromwich Albion and Everton, it seems the Blues are interested in making up for lost time and bringing him back, according to ESPN FC.

Also, the Stamford Bridge club are understood to be very interested in reigniting their interest in John Stones, a player they see as so talented that they were willing to spend £40 million on him last year.
 

Stones was a priority signing for Jose Mourinho last season as he saw cracks starting to appear in his ageing defence. As it happened, Chelsea failed to acquire his signature and the Portuguese lost his job at the club after losing nine of their opening 16 league matches.

The defender has been closely monitored by Chelsea since his move to Everton, while Lukaku has emerged as one of the best strikers in Europe having hit 45 goals in all competitions since moving to Goodison Park on a permanent transfer in the summer of 2014.

He has scored 18 goals in the top flight this season, at least seven more than anyone at Chelsea.

John Stones has committed four defensive errors in the Premier League this season – the second most at Everton.
